Wau Airport is an important airport located in the country of South Sudan. It is a public airport that serves the city of Wau, which is the capital of the Western Bahr el Ghazal region. The airport plays a crucial role in connecting Wau to the rest of the country and the world, facilitating both domestic and international air travel. In this essay, we will explore the history of Wau Airport, its facilities, and its significance to the region.

Wau Airport has a rich history that dates back to the colonial period when it was originally built by the British government in the early 1940s. At that time, the airport was known as Wau Aerodrome and served as a vital link for air travel between other regions of Sudan, as well as neighboring countries. Over the years, the airport has undergone several renovations and expansions to keep up with the growing demand for air travel in the region.

Today, Wau Airport is a modern facility with a single asphalt runway that measures 2,400 meters in length. The airport is capable of handling small to medium-sized aircraft and has the capacity to accommodate both domestic and international flights. The airport is equipped with basic facilities such as passenger terminals, cargo handling services, and aviation services to ensure the smooth operation of flights.

One of the key features of Wau Airport is its role in facilitating humanitarian aid missions in South Sudan. The country has been plagued by conflict and instability for many years, leading to widespread displacement and suffering among its population. Humanitarian organizations rely on Wau Airport as a hub for delivering essential supplies, medical aid, and food to the people in need. The airport plays a critical role in supporting humanitarian efforts and providing relief to those affected by the ongoing crisis.
